The white. Bleached to a clean white — bright, but never clinical. The fabric softens with each wash and holds the color with normal care. Yellowing is avoided by drying fully and storing dry; oxygen bleach is safe for occasional brightening.
The fabric. 100% linen at 170 GSM, European, medium weight. Breathable in summer, insulating in winter. Naturally absorbent, releases moisture quickly. The flax is European; cut and sewn in our Latvian workshop. No subcontracting.
A bed made entirely in white linen. Linen has no sheen, so a whole bed in white reads soft rather than starched — the opposite of the pressed hotel look that the same color gives in cotton percale, and the reason people who tried white cotton and disliked it often get on with this (the two fibers compared). It is also the practical one: white is the only color of ours that takes oxygen bleach, so a white bed is one you launder back rather than replace, and pieces bought years apart still match because bleached white is a fixed target rather than a batch.
Sizes. US, EU and Australian mattress sizes, plus a custom width and length on duvet covers for a duvet that fits no chart. Fitted sheets add a pocket depth from 8 to 22 in / 20 to 55 cm; bed-skirt drops run 10 to 30 in / 20 to 70 cm. Every size is listed on the product itself, and the size guide converts between the regions.
Care. Wash before first use — cold water, delicate cycle. Settles after 1–2 cold washes. Ongoing care at 40 °C. Oxygen bleach safe for white linen; no chlorine bleach.
Certification. OEKO-TEX Standard 100 — fabric and thread tested for substances that affect skin and lungs.
